레지스트리로 맥주소 변경하는 방법

2019. 12. 12. 23:23 / 서기랑

 요즘 컴퓨터는 맥주소를 플래시 메모리에 저장하기 때문에 사용자가 원한다면 언제든지 맥주소의 변경이 가능하다.

 맥주소의 변경은 보통 네트워크 어댑터의 설정을 통해서 변경을 한다.

 하지만 간혹 네트워크 어댑터의 설정에서 맥주소의 변경과 관련된 부분(로컬 관리 주소)이 보이지 않거나 설정을 변경해도 반영이 되지 않는 경우가 발생하기도 하는데 이런 경우에는 레지스트리에서도 맥주소의 변경이 가능하니 이를 이용해 보는 건 어떨까 한다.

 (레지스트리의 값을 변경하기 전에는 백업을 해두는 것이 좋다.)


레지스트리로 맥주소 변경하는 방법

1. 네트워크 어댑터의 맥주소 확인.

 레지스트리에서 맥주소를 변경하기 위해서는 현제 사용하고 있는 네트워크 어댑터의 GUID를 알아야 하는데 GUID를 알려면 그전에 먼저 현재 사용하는 맥주소를 알아야 한다.


 먼저 cmd를 실행한 뒤 'ipconfig/all'명령어를 입력하고 설명 부분(Description)을 확인하여 사용하고 있는 네트워크 어댑터를 찾은 뒤에 해당 어댑터의 물리적 주소(Physical Address)를 확인하도록 하자.

 (설명은 네트워크 어댑터의 이름이며, 물리적 주소는 맥주소라고 보면 된다.)

ipconfig/all


2. GUID 확인.

 물리적 주소를 확인했다면 이번에는 'getmac'명령어를 입력하도록 하자.

 한 가지 혹은 몇 가지 값이 나올 텐데 위에서 확인한 물리적 주소 값과 과 같은 값을 찾은 뒤 오른쪽의 전송 이름에 있는 {} 안에 있는 값을 확인하도록 하자.

 해당 값이 GUID이다.

getmac


3. 레지스트리 편집기.

 GUID를 확인했다면 이제 레지스트리 편집기를 실행하도록 하자.

 시작 메뉴에서 찾아서 실행하거나 [윈도우 키 + R]을 눌러 실행창에서 regedit를 입력하여 실행하면 된다.

윈도우 실행 창


4. 경로 이동.

 레지스트리 편집기를 실행했다면 아래의 경로로 이동하도록 하자.

 (복사해서 붙여 넣어도 된다. 다만 복사할 때 뒤에 추가적인 내용이 붙을 수 있으니 메모장에 복사한 뒤 다시 복사하는 것이 좋을 것이다.)

컴퓨터\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\{4d36e972-e325-11ce-bfc1-08002be10318}

레지스트리 경로 이동


5. 어댑터 찾기.

 경로에 이동했다면 0001, 0002, 0003과 같은 하위 경로를 볼 수 있을 것이다.

 이 경로 중에 하나가 현재 사용하고 있는 네트워크 어댑터라고 보면 되는데 네트워크 어댑터를 찾기 위해서는 하위 경로를 클릭하면서 DriverDesc와 NetCfgInstanceID의 데이터 값이 일치하는지를 확인해야 한다.

 (DriverDesc가 네트워크 어댑터 명, NetCfgInstanceID가 GUID이다.)

NetCfgInstanceID


6. 변경할 맥주소 값 추가.

 DriverDesc와 NetCfgInstanceID가 일치하는 경로를 찾았다면 이제 여기에 변경하고 싶은 맥주소 값을 새로 만들어서 넣어야 한다.


 우선 마우스 우클릭을 하여 새로 만들기 -> 문자열 값(String Value)을 생성한 뒤 이름을 NetworkAddress라고 변경하도록 하자.

문자열 값 추가


 그다음 생성한 값을 더블클릭하여 값 데이터에 변경하고 싶은 맥주소를 입력한 뒤 확인 버튼을 클릭하면 된다.

맥주소 변경


7. 재부팅 및 확인.

 레지스트리 편집을 완료했다면 컴퓨터를 재부팅한 뒤 cmd에서 'getmac'를 입력하여 맥주소가 변경됐는지 확인해보면 된다.

getmac


그 외.

 조금 번거로워 보일 수 있으니 막상 해보면 그리 어렵지는 않을 것이다.

 다만 레지스트리를 건드리는 것이니 만큼 만약을 위해 작업 전에 먼저 레지스트리를 백업하는 것을 추천한다.

관련 글 링크

 

 레지스트리 백업 방법

 컴퓨터 맥주소 변경 방법